One thing I've never seen mentioned on TDF is wigs and fuzzy blankets do't go together. Even the blanket that came with my doll is a nightmare for wigs. These blankets create thousand of little fuzz balls and every single one will end up in the wig. What's really impressive is how these fuzz balls seem to be magnetic to wig hair strands. You will have tons of tangles that are beyond comprehension and a little fuzz ball can be found in the center of each one. Fun stuff!

With regard to staining I've found it's the coloured elastane band that causes the problem rather than the whole of the cap so I bought some white elastane tape and sewed that round the inside of the cap to cover the built-in band.
There's some great advice on wig care for dolls on this site and also some useful videos on youtube for TG/TS about long-term wig care, After conditioning I highly recommend applying hair repair oil to the wig to give it shine and reduce tangling.
